<h2 class="wp-block-heading">How to Choose the Right Doula (Trust This Process)</h2>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">1. Pay Attention to How You Feel—Not Just Their Resume</h3>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Yes, experience matters. Training matters. Reviews matter.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">But more than anything:<br><strong>How do you feel when you talk to them?</strong></p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Do you feel safe?<br>Seen?<br>Heard without needing to explain yourself?</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Because during labor, you won’t be analyzing credentials—you’ll be responding to <em>energy</em>.</p>



<hr class="w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ity"/>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">2. Alignment Over Aesthetics</h3>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">It’s easy to be drawn to a polished Instagram feed or beautifully branded website.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">But ask yourself: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>Do they support <em>your</em> birth preferences?</li>



<li>Are they flexible if things shift?</li>



<li>Do they respect your intuition, even if it changes in the moment?</li>
</ul>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The right doula doesn’t impose—she supports.</p>



<hr class="w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ity"/>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">3. Ask the Questions That Actually Matter</h3>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Skip the surface-level questions and go deeper: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li>How do you handle unexpected changes during labor?</li>



<li>What is your approach if I feel overwhelmed or panicked?</li>



<li>How do you support partners in the room?</li>



<li>What does advocacy look like to you?</li>
</ul>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">You’re not hiring a service.<br>You’re inviting someone into one of the most intimate days of your life.</p>



<hr class="w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ity"/>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">4. Consider Your Birth Setting</h3>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Whether you’re planning a home birth, birth center, or hospital delivery in Los Angeles, your doula should feel confident and experienced in that environment.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Each setting comes with its own rhythm, policies, and dynamics.<br>The right doula knows how to navigate them <em>without disrupting your experience.</em></p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ading has-text-align-center">How I Actually Balance Both Roles</h2>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">The truth is, it’s not chaotic — it’s intuitive.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Before your birth, I spend a lot of time with you and your partner during our prenatal visits, showing both of you comfort measures, how to use counterpressure effectively, how to work with a rebozo, and how to breathe together during critical moments. I don’t expect anyone to remember everything when labor is happening, but I’m there to gently cue you with a simple, <em>“Remember…”</em> so you can focus on the birth itself.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">After years of attending births, I’ve learned the rhythm. Labor has waves. There are intense moments, and then there are pauses. Those pauses allow me to step back and document without ever compromising support.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Here’s what that often looks like in real time:</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">• <strong>During early labor</strong> — I document more freely while offering steady presence and guidance.<br>• <strong>During active labor</strong> — I move fluidly between counterpressure, encouragement, and capturing emotion.<br>• <strong>During transition</strong> — I am almost always hands-on.<br>• <strong>During pushing</strong> — I document strategically while staying grounded beside you.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">If at any point you need me fully present, the camera rests. No hesitation.</p>



<p class="wp-block-paragraph">Because no image is more important than your experience.</p>
